New York Payroll Employment By County for The Private Natural Resources And Mining Industry in November, 2020
Updated on October 9, 2022.

According to recent data from the US Bureau of Labor Statistics, in November, 2020, New York added -4,740 number of jobs to the private natural resources and mining industry. Among New York counties, New York added the highest number of jobs (7), followed by Sullivan (5), and Warren (4).
